TriadicOrange, Sky Blue and Hot Pink Color Meaning
Bright orange meets light sky blue and hot pink. The bold pink lifts the airy tones, giving a roller-coaster mood like bright cars climbing against a pale summer sky.
It shows up in amusement and youth branding, loud packaging, and playful, energetic interiors.

Orange, Sky Blue and Hot Pink in Fashion & Interior
At home this feels bold and fun, like a roller-coaster room. Use sky blue on big pieces, add hot pink in accents, and the orange as a warm pop. In clothes, the hot pink lifts the airy tones. Best in summer; add white to keep it fresh.
